Man Fatally Shot In Florence

LOS ANGELES (CBSLA.com) — Authorities Tuesday were investigating a the fatal shooting of an 18-year-old man in the Florence-Firestone area.

A Los Angeles County Sheriff's deputy found Alfonso Maldonado lying on a curb while he was patrolling the neighborhood around 10:30 p.m. Monday in the 900 block of Holmes Avenue, officials said.

Deputies said the teen was shot multiple times.

"The victim was transported to a local hospital where he was pronounced dead," Dep. Kelvin Moody said.

"It hurts my heart," said Alfonso's mother Dolores Perez, who also lost her daughter to illness nine years ago.

Maldonado was finishing high school when he was killed and would have been the first person to graduate in his family.

A motive for the shooting was unclear and detectives were trying to determine if it was gang-related.
